What is Agentic AI?
Agentic AI refers to AI systems that can perform tasks autonomously, make decisions, use tools, and interact with external systems with minimal human intervention. These systems are often designed to automate workflows and solve complex tasks using AI models and reasoning capabilities.

How is Agentic AI different from traditional automation?
Traditional automation follows predefined rules and workflows, while Agentic AI systems can make decisions, adapt to new situations, and interact dynamically with tools, APIs, and users using AI models.
